Action Forms original first person shooter, Chasm: The Rift was released in 1997 for "mouse and keyboard". The developers later went on to make the Carnivores series. Said franchise has four installments so far, three of the first Carnivores games was developed by Action Form. The fourth was made by Sunstorm Interactive. In 2001, Action Forms announced Duke Nukem: Endangered Species. It was to be a hunting game (somewhat similar to the Carnivores games) where the players could hunt everything from dinosaurs to snakes. The game was supposed to use an improved version of the engine used in the carnivore series, but the whole project got canceled when Action Forms decided to start working on their own new project -- Vivisector. Vivisector: Best inside was released in 2005, Action Forms started working on the unique, uncanny and slow-paced first person shooter Cryostasis: Sleep of Reason.
